Aroma: Seductive bouquet of sweet, ripe berries, plums, and delicate licorice. Taste: Soft and powerful with abundant aromatic richness, fruit, and freshness on the palate; fleshy, full-bodied, with excellent structure from the tightly woven yet silky tannins; a wine full of elegance and finesse right through to the long, lingering finish. At Château Rozier, the harvest begins on September 18th with the Merlot grapes and ends on September 29th with the Cabernet Franc. All grapes are harvested by hand into small baskets and fermented using traditional methods. The wine matures for approximately 15 months in oak barrels, one-third new, one-third one-year-old, and one-third two-year-old.
